Виртуальный каталог, указывающий на другой сервер

У меня есть 2 веб-сервера, размещенных в Azure (веб-сайт - Windows - IIS):

  • example.com - запущенный на заказ сайт ASP.NET.
  • blog.example.com - Запуск WordPress.

Я хочу пометить эти два сайта в "example.com". Когда пользователь войдет в блог, URL будет http://example.com/blog/... (вместо blog.copyleaks.com)

Итак, на мой взгляд, у меня есть два варианта:

  1. Создайте новый виртуальный каталог в example.com: "/blog/" и переместите в него все файлы из blog.example.com. Теперь blog.example.com больше не используется.
  2. Создайте новый виртуальный каталог в example.com: "/blog/", но вместо перемещения файлов в новый виртуальный каталог сервер выполнит довольно редирект. URL не будет изменен, но страницы будут обслуживаться с другого сервера. Это возможно?

Первый вариант (номер 1) для меня плохой из-за безопасности. WordPress хорошо известен из-за проблем с безопасностью...

Я хочу реализовать второй (2) вариант. Это возможно? Как?

1 ответ

Взгляните на маршрутизацию запросов приложений (ARR), которая может выступать в качестве обратного прокси: http://www.iis.net/learn/extensions/url-rewrite-module/reverse-proxy-with-url-rewrite-v2-and-application-request-routing

Другие вопросы по тегам